Modular dart launcher with status indicator
Abstract
A dart launcher launches a dart by placing the dart within a launcher bore formed within a launcher body. The launcher body also defines a central bore coupled inline with a tubing string and in fluid communication with the launcher bore. The launcher bore is formed at an angle to the central bore. A release assembly is coupled to the launcher body and includes a release rod protruding into the launcher bore to selectively release the dart. A visual indicator assembly is coupled to the launcher body downstream from the release assembly and includes a flapper protruding into the launcher bore. The release assembly is actuated by the dart rotating the flapper to rotate an arm from a non-released position to a released position.

1 . A wellbore drop member launcher comprising:
a launcher body defining a central bore having a central bore axis, the launcher body having a lower end configured to attach to a string of pipe extending into a wellbore; the launcher body defining a launcher bore having a launcher bore axis at an angle to the central bore axis, the launcher bore in fluid communication with the central bore; a release assembly coupled to the launcher body and having a release rod protruding into the launcher bore to prevent movement of a drop member positioned within the launcher bore in a drop member hold position; wherein the release assembly is configured to move the release rod to a drop member release position to selectively release the drop member positioned within the launcher bore; and a visual indicator assembly coupled to the launcher body and configured to provide a mechanically produced visual indication that the drop member has moved from the launcher bore to the central bore.
2 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 1 , wherein the release assembly comprises:
a piston assembly coupled to the release rod and configured to move the release rod between the drop member hold position and the drop member release position; and wherein the piston assembly biases the release rod to the drop member hold position.
3 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 2 , further comprising:
a release body housing interposed between the piston assembly and the launcher body, the release rod at least partially disposed within the release body housing when in the drop member hold position and a portion of the piston assembly coupling to the release rod within the release body housing; a window having a length formed in a portion of a release body housing; an indicator screw threaded into the portion of the piston assembly so that an end of the screw is visible through the window; and wherein the indicator screw moves from a first end of the window to a second end of the window when the piston assembly operates to move the release rod between the drop member hold and the drop member release positions, providing a visual indication of release assembly actuation.
4 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 3 , wherein:
the release rod defines a pressure passage extending from an end of the release rod disposed within the launcher bore through a center of the release rod to an annular chamber within the release body housing; and wherein the pressure passage is configured to equalize pressure between the release body housing and the launcher bore to prevent premature dart member release.
5 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 2 , wherein the piston assembly is a hydraulically actuated piston assembly.
6 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 2 , wherein the piston assembly is a pneumatically actuated piston assembly.
7 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 1 , wherein the visual indicator assembly comprises:
an indicator bore defined by the launcher body extending from an exterior of the launcher body to the launcher bore; an indicator housing coupled to the launcher body proximate to the indicator bore; an indicator rod extending through the indicator housing into the indicator bore; a flapper on an end portion of the indicator rod; wherein the flapper is perpendicular to the indicator rod and extends from the indicator bore into the launcher bore; an arm secured to an end of the indicator rod that protrudes from the indicator housing and located so as to be visible to an operator; wherein the arm extends from the indicator rod perpendicular to the indicator rod and parallel to the flapper; and wherein as the drop member passes the flapper it rotates the flapper, indicator rod, and arm to indicate release of the drop member.
8 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 7 , further comprising:
a pre-release detent formed in a surface of the indicator rod; a post-release detent formed in a surface of the indicator rod axially aligned with the pre-release detent and circumferentially spaced from the pre-release detent; and a spring plunger disposed within the indicator housing and adapted to insert into the pre-release detent to limit rotation of the indicator rod prior to passage of the drop member; and the spring plunger further adapted to release from the pre-release detent to allow rotation of the indicator, rod as the drop member passes and insert into the post-release detent to prevent further rotation of the indicator rod following passage of the drop member.
9 . The wellbore drop member launcher of claim 7 , wherein the flapper, indicator rod, and arm rotate ninety degrees.
